Keep in mind, those in the US cannot check the prices or availability outside the US. There are no indicators to us as to where it can be sold, nor it is easy to change our addresses (with over a hundred countries, we would need a valid mailing address in each one, and an huge amount of time; by the time we checked each one, the deal may be gone or I know that I'd have long ceased to care about posting it for those who are interested to enjoy). And although Amazon had only been charging the wireless access charge and VAT on free titles to international customers prior to the Agency model, it is now up to the publisher to set the price in every single country.
I've already started seeing reports of truly free books in AU, so it is apparently only a matter of time before other countries have the same. All three are from Christian publishers; one is non-fiction, while with the thriller it's hard to tell how much that is a part of the plot/contents. |
